Robotics Engineer
Los Angeles, CA, USA
Build robots that move the physical world.
Warp is rebuilding logistics with AI, robotics, and software. We've doubled our business every year for the past three years.
We're looking for exceptional builders who want to solve real world problems at scale. If you've been building robots in your garage, competing in robotics competitions, contributing to open source projects, or constantly experimenting with new hardware and AI, we want to meet you.
This isn't a research internship. You'll build systems that are tested in real operating environments alongside experienced engineers and company founders.
What You'll BuildYou'll help design, prototype, and deploy robotics systems that improve how physical goods move through Warp's logistics network.
Your work may include:
- Robotics software and controls
- Computer vision and perception
- Embedded systems and sensor integration
- AI powered planning and automation
- Rapid hardware prototyping
- Testing systems in live warehouse and logistics environments
Every project is focused on solving real operational problems, not building demos.
What We're Looking For- Currently pursuing or recently completed a degree in Robotics, Mechanical Engineering, Electrical Engineering, Computer Science, or a related field
- Strong programming skills in Python or C++
- Experience with robotics, embedded systems, computer vision, or AI
- Comfortable building hardware and software together
- Curiosity, ownership, and the ability to learn quickly
- A portfolio of projects that shows you love building things
We care far more about what you've built than where you went to school or what your GPA is.
Bonus Points- ROS or ROS2
- CAD experience (SolidWorks, Fusion 360, Onshape, or similar)
- NVIDIA Jetson, Raspberry Pi, Arduino, STM32, or other embedded platforms
- Machine learning or computer vision experience
- Robotics competitions, hackathons, or open source contributions
- Experience building drones, autonomous systems, or other physical products
